About

Microsoft Defender for Office 365

Microsoft Defender for Office 365 (MDO) protects email and collaboration workloads against phishing, malware, spoofing, and business email compromise. It provides preset policies, detonation (Safe Attachments), time-of-click URL protection (Safe Links), post-delivery detection and hunting (Threat Explorer + AIR), and attack simulation training.

When to use

Securing Exchange Online mail flow and Microsoft 365 collaboration (Teams, SharePoint, OneDrive). Use this skill for plan/preset decisions, control configuration, drift detection, and SOC operations on email incidents.

Do not use this skill for endpoint protection (defender-for-endpoint), broader cross-workload investigation (defender-xdr), or SharePoint oversharing before Copilot rollout (purview-copilot-oversharing).

Pick the plan, then the preset

| If you need... | Plan / SKU | Notes | |---|---|---| | Safe Links, Safe Attachments, anti-phish, anti-spam, anti-malware | MDO Plan 1 | Bundled with M365 Business Premium and E3 add-on | | Threat Explorer, Real-time detections, AIR, attack simulation training, automated investigation | MDO Plan 2 | Bundled with M365 E5 / MDO P2 | | Cross-tenant secure collaboration (B2B/B2C with MDO) | MDO P1 or P2 | Apply preset to guest senders too |

| Posture | Preset to apply | Who it fits | |---|---|---| | Default healthy baseline, low admin overhead | Standard preset | Most enterprises - apply to all users | | High-target, regulated, or executive-heavy estate | Strict preset | Tier-0 admins, finance, exec mailboxes | | Custom carve-out (e.g. vendor with broken SPF) | Custom policy with priority above preset | Use sparingly - documents drift risk |

> Rule of thumb: apply Standard preset to all users as the floor, Strict preset to > high-risk groups (executives, finance, IT admins, legal) as the ceiling. Custom policies > only where presets genuinely don't fit - every custom policy is a future drift source.

Approach

  1. Confirm licensing and mail flow — Verify MDO P1 vs P2 in admin centre. Confirm

Exchange Online accepts mail directly (or via an upstream gateway). MDO with a third-party secure email gateway (SEG) in front is a common pattern but reduces some detections - use Enhanced Filtering for Connectors to preserve original sender IP. Verify: Get-EnhancedFilteringConfig shows your inbound connector configured.

  1. Enable email authentication — SPF, DKIM, and DMARC for every sending domain.

DMARC starts at p=none (monitor), moves to quarantine, then reject. Without DMARC, spoofing detections are weaker. Verify: DMARC at p=reject with aggregate reports flowing for 30+ days.

  1. Apply preset security policies — Standard preset to all users. Strict preset to a

targeted group (executives, finance, IT admins). Presets auto-update to Microsoft's recommendations; custom policies do not. Verify: Preset policy report shows ≥ 95% of users covered by Standard or Strict.

  1. Configure impersonation protection — In the anti-phishing policy (Strict preset

includes this), add the specific users (executives, CFO, exec assistants) and domains (your own, partner domains often impersonated) to impersonation protection. Mailbox intelligence on automatically learns the rest. Verify: anti-phishing policy shows 5-15 protected users (don't list everyone - dilutes detection) and 1-3 trusted domains.

  • Don't disable Safe Links rewriting for "user experience". The rewrite is the

detection - removing it removes Safe Links entirely. Use the Do not rewrite list for specific allow-listed services instead.

  • Impersonation protection on a small specific list. Listing every user dilutes the

detection. 5-15 named protected users; let mailbox intelligence handle the rest.

  • Allow entries in TABL are temporary. They override detections. 30-day max, review

weekly, remove or replace with a proper exclusion.

  • DMARC reject is the goal, not p=none. p=none is a 30-day monitor stop, not a destination.
  • MDO + third-party SEG = configure Enhanced Filtering. Otherwise MDO sees the SEG IP as

the sender and detections degrade.

  • Don't bypass MDO with mail flow rules. Exception rules ("skip filtering for messages

from X") are how attackers slip through. Use TABL or impersonation exclusions instead.

Common anti-patterns

  • "Use only custom policies because preset is too strict" - Locks you out of Microsoft's

automatic tuning. Apply preset; carve out specific exclusions.

  • "Disable Safe Links rewriting because it breaks the helpdesk link" - Removes the

detection. Add the specific URL to Do not rewrite.

  • "Allow this vendor domain in TABL permanently" - Permanent allow = permanent bypass.

Fix the underlying SPF/DKIM/DMARC issue at the sender or use a connector-level allow.

  • "Add all 5,000 users to impersonation protection" - Detection becomes noise. Target the

top-impersonated 10-50 named users.

  • "DMARC at p=none indefinitely" - You're collecting reports but never enforcing.

Quarantine within 60 days, reject within 90.

  • "User-reported phish goes to a shared mailbox we check weekly" - Use the Submissions

portal so AIR and Threat Explorer fire. Shared mailbox loses the tooling.

  • "Attack simulation training assigned to everyone every quarter" - Engagement collapses.

Target clickers and credential submitters only.

  • "MDO behind a third-party SEG with default config" - All inbound looks like it's from

the SEG IP. Enable Enhanced Filtering for Connectors.
